In this paper, several typical variable step-size LMS (VSS-LMS) algorithms are first applied to adaptive Fourier analysis of noisy sinusoidal signals, which were developed in the context of system identification. A simplified VSS-LMS (SVSS-LMS) algorithm is then proposed to perform the same task, which, on the whole, indicates nice performance comparable to that of most of the typical VSS-LMS algorithms, and requires fewer multiplications as well as user parameters. In-depth performance analysis is provided for the proposed algorithm. Difference equations are derived that describe its dynamics, and elegant closed-form expressions are also worked out for its steady-state performance. Extensive simulations are conducted to confirm its effectiveness, and to clarify the validity of the analytical findings.
